A Display Revolution

DSC00855

The new HUAWEI MatePad Pro 12.2” is pushing the boundaries of tablet displays with its innovative Tandem OLED PaperMatte screen. Capable of reaching an astounding 2000 nits of brightness, it delivers stunning HDR visuals, ensuring lifelike colours even if you’re outdoors in bright sunlight. This display goes beyond just brightness, incorporating cutting-edge anti-sparkle and nanoscale anti-glare etching technologies, alongside magnetron nano optical layers to reduce light interference and glare. The result? A viewing experience that feels as comfortable as reading from paper, regardless of your surroundings.

Huawei has also overhauled the writing experience with this display. The nanoscale anti-glare etching creates a textured surface at the nano level, enhancing the tactile feedback. When writing, you’ll experience the familiar vibrations, subtle rustling sound, and grip of pen on paper, making digital note-taking feel remarkably natural.

HUAWEI Glide Keyboard: Portable, Functional

Miro 1

The MatePad Pro solves the most frustrating aspect of using a tablet with a stylus—the lack of a dedicated storage solution. The all-new HUAWEI Glide Keyboard changes the game with its integrated stylus storage and charging. Simply place the stylus into its slot in the keyboard case, and it pairs automatically with the tablet; no need to ever worry about pairing again. Plus, the stylus charges directly while stored, going from zero to full in just an hour. This ensures your stylus is always ready when you are.

True to its name, the Glide Keyboard is smooth in every way. In Studio Mode, the tablet’s bottom edge hovers above the touchpad to keep the keyboard steady and avoid accidental touches. You can even disable the touchpad entirely to prevent any unintended touches during creative work.

While tablets have become easier to use over time, switching between modes often requires multiple steps. The Glide Keyboard’s magnetic dynamic hinge simplifies this process, making it as smooth as flipping open a laptop. The Glide Keyboard uses anti-stain materials that can stay pristine. Whether it’s a splash of coffee, a few drops of cooking oil, or smudges from lipstick, you can just wipe it away.

GoPaint: Digital Art Revolution

Untitled 2.13.1

The GoPaint app on the new tablet introduces a suite of groundbreaking digital tools, including the all-new Splatter and Fluid brushes, to unlock new levels of creativity. The Splatter brushes allow users to create mesmerizing ink splatters with just a hover and a double tap—about 12mm above the screen. It adds a playful twist to digital art, making the creative process more engaging. The GoPaint features 15 different Splatter brushes, each inspired by real-world splatters like spray paint, scattered tree leaves, and the iconic works of Pollock. Realistic textures offer users an authentic creation experience with more options, such as rocky surface, gold silk, silver silk and rice paper, as if they were painting on paper. The app also introduces Fluid brushes, designed to replicate the natural blending effects of liquid pigments like ink and watercolor. Fluid brushes deliver incredibly vivid and lifelike blending effects, bringing your digital paintings to life.

A Battery that Outlasts Your Longest Days

The MatePad Pro 12.2” packs a massive 10,100 mAh battery. You get up to 14 hours of non-stop local video playback. The tablet also comes with cutting-edge fast charging capabilities, Smart Power Conserve, and more, to make work, study, and leisure hassle-free. The MatePad Pro 12.2” supports 100 W HUAWEI SuperCharge, which takes the tablet from zero to 100% in just 55 minutes. Plus, with Smart Power Conserve, the tablet can stay on standby for an impressive 380 days.
